GOOD NEWS FOR ALBUQUERQUE REAL ESTATE
Smart Money Magazine said Albuquerque's housing market appears to be in the best position to make a comeback. Researchers at the magazine said the nationwide rate of decline in sales is slowing and that the government takeover of Freddie Mac and Fannie Mae could boost the housing market by making borrowing easier for buyers. That's helping homeowners nationwide.
In Albuquerque, home inventories have leveled off and the number of homes on the market has remained level. Experts caution not to expect a rapid rebound. It could still take years for the housing industry to recover entirely. In Albuquerque, however, Smart Money Magazine seems to think we are ready to start seeing an increase in sales prices than a decrease.
Other cities that had high rankings in the magazine are Birmingham, Al., Buffalo, N.Y., and Charlotte, N.C.
